Legal Officer – Kaabong – Mercy Corps



PROGRAM/DEPARTMENT SUMMARY:
Mercy Corps has been operating in Uganda since 2006. It has and continues to implement programs in Acholi and Karamoja sub regions. Mercy Corps is taking a community-led, market driven approach to address poverty and food insecurity needs through interventions that get to the root causes and contributing factors of economic vulnerability. Donors include the United States Agency for International Development (USAID), United States, DFID, NIKE Foundation.


GENERAL POSITION SUMMARY:
The Legal officers’ role and responsibilities mainly will be categorized into: Legal awareness on land laws and policies, Alternative dispute resolution through legal aid clinics, Capacity building of land administrative and management structures


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
Offer Legal advice to people on their Land Rights for during community outreaches and those who report to seek for advice in office


Provide information on women’s Land Rights to the community, through radio talk shows and during community sensitizations


Carryout community awareness on Land Rights


Refer intricate cases to other Legal Aid providers and courts of Laws


Pass on information materials on Land Rights/policies/law to clients


Systematically maintain proper records of clients visits to the Office for advise and mediation


Write and submit reports on a routine basis, (weekly, monthly, quarterly reports)


Liaise with other relevant institutions and departments of government that deal with land matters in order to optimize protection of peoples Land Rights of the people in Karamoja

KNOWLEDGE AND EXPERIENCE:
Preferably a degree in Law, LLB or its equivalence from a recognized institution
Between 3-5 years of legal practice
Certificate in legal practice will be added advantage
Familiarity of land laws and policies will be added advantage
Understanding of land tenure systems with specific focus on Karamoja and traditional land management structures in Karamoja is a great asset
